So, what is dés de tomate?
"Dés de tomate" is a French term that refers to diced tomatoes. These small, evenly-sized pieces of tomato are a popular ingredient in a wide range of dishes, from salads to pasta sauces to salsas. Dicing the tomatoes allows for easier incorporation into recipes and also creates a more visually appealing dish. Tomatoes themselves are a great source of vitamins A and C, and are known for their bright, tangy flavor. Whether fresh or canned, adding "dés de tomate" to your next meal will surely add a burst of color and flavor to your dish.
